MINISTER FOR AGRICULTURE CONTINUES FAMILIARIZATION TOUR WITH A VISIT TO AGRICULTURAL DIVISIONS IN THE SOUTH.
Minister with responsibility for Agriculture, Hon. Alfred Prospere, on the continuation of his tour, got a firsthand look and update of the ongoing developments at the Volet Agricultural Livestock Centre.
The livestock station, currently in phase one, will see the development of approximately 30 acres of land, where its operations will focus on growing the livestock industry in tangible ways once completed. Services to be offered will include Animal health advisory and treatment services to facilitate improved livestock production.
Minister Prospere expressed his satisfaction with the station's progress and noted that the station will provide many opportunities, particularly for young farmers, by producing breeding stock and allowing them to multiply for the purpose of selling to farmers.
“I see tremendous opportunities for our young people to get into livestock production, and tremendous opportunity for our current livestock farmers to benefit,” he said.
The second leg of the tour continued with a visit to Regions 3 and 4 where the minister met with the staff of the regions to discuss the programs in place for farmers. This was followed by a visit to the Praedial Larceny unit where the minister was apprised of the various challenges being faced by the unit.
As Minister Prospere continues along his familiarization tour, he reaffirmed his commitment to improving the agriculture industry of Saint Lucia.
